Stratford Centre closed ‘until further notice’ after fatal stabbing
Flowers laid outside Stratford Centre. Picture: Ken Mears - Credit: Archant
A major shopping centre in Newham is shut after a fatal stabbing last night.
All shops and access to Stratford Centre have been closed “until further notice”, Met Police tweeted earlier this afternoon.
A man believed to be in his early 20s was found injured with stab wounds when officers and ambulance crews received reports of a disturbance outside the building at 9.30pm yesterday.
He was pronounced dead at the scene an hour later.
Detectives think he got into an altercation with a group of young men with a friend before being knifed to death.

His next of kin have been informed and formal identification and a post-mortem will take place in due course.
Police ask anyone with information to call 0208 721 4005 quoting CAD 7391/20 March or Crimestoppers anonymously on 0800 555 111.
